The global body shaping equipment market is expected to increase from USD 5.76 billion in 2021 to USD 12.6 billion by 2027, at a CAGR of 13.96% during 2022- 2027. Growing demand for medical aesthetic treatments is driving the growth of the body sculpting devices market. Medical aesthetics is one of the rapidly growing industries, as the aging population and introduction of advanced procedures provide new growth opportunities for the market. Micro-needling and skin tightening treatments are among the fastest-growing medical aesthetic treatments globally.
Body sculpting devices are designed to improve the appearance of the body. Body contouring treatments are MI and non-invasive surgical procedures that improve body shape and skin texture, such as skin firming, resurfacing, and other benefits. These procedures require highly skilled medical professionals. Tummy tuck or liposuction, male mastectomy, and arm lifts are some of the procedures performed with body sculpting equipment.

Application Insights
Non-surgical skin tightening is the leading segment in the application, holding the highest share in the global body shaping devices market, it is expected to grow at the fastest rate during the forecast period, with a CAGR of 14.81%. The increasing demand for skin tightening devices is attributed to the rising aging population, which has led to an increase in skin sagging issues and increasing concerns about skin problems. The American Society of Dermatological Surgery( ASDS) reported that approximately 70 percent of consumers considered cosmetic surgery in 2018, with 57 percent specifically considering non-surgical skin tightening treatments. The segment is also experiencing continuous technological advancements.
North America accounted for the highest market share in the global skin resurfacing market owing to the increasing adoption of advanced technological equipment, the presence of a skilled labor force, and higher disposable income. Asia Pacific is expected to grow faster over the forecast period owing to economic growth, the medical tourism market, and increasing disposable income.
The growing obese population has created tremendous opportunities and demand for liposuction/ lipolysis and cellulite treatment devices. According to the American Society of Aesthetic Plastic Surgeons( ASAPS), the non-surgical fat reduction was second only to injections in demand in 2018. However, due to the high complications associated with the surgical liposuction procedure and its high cost, many companies are focusing on developing and offering minimally invasive lipolysis devices. For example, Solta Medical and Alma Lasers of Bausch Health Companies now offer the next generation of minimally invasive liposuction systems( ultrasound and laser).
Insights by Gender
The need for non-surgical skin tightening and fat reduction is predominant among women. The most common cosmetic procedures for women with the fastest growth since 2018 include Botox, hyaluronic acid, and non-surgical fat reduction procedures. About 92 percent of American women have undergone cosmetic surgery. In comparison, only 8% of men underwent cosmetic surgery in 2020, indicating that women are the major consumers of the global body-shaping devices market.
In recent years, however, body sculpting treatments have become one of the most important procedures for men. Growing demand for jaw contouring, tummy tuck, and gynecomastia, body sculpting treatments has grown significantly in the male population over the past few years.
Insights by age group
The 35 50- year- old age group dominates the global body shaping devices market in this age group segment. This age group seeks the most cosmetic procedures such as liposuction, belly fat reduction, and breast reduction. The 35- 50 age group is expected to grow at the highest CAGR of 14.35% during the forecast period. In contrast, antiaging surgical and nonsurgical procedures to reduce wrinkles and rejuvenate the face were most popular among those under 34.
